A London record store with real history.

When In Yer Ear closed, Michael Todd opened Speed City Records on March 1, 1997. What started as a downtown record shop became one of London's lasting independent music stores by staying useful, buying well, and keeping stock moving. That history still matters. Speed City has real roots in London, Ontario and a reputation that was earned over time.
